Radio Times: Seasons 1-4, 1963-1966

William Hartnell and Carole-Anne Ford

Above: William Hartnell, the First Doctor, pictured with Carole-Anne Ford who played his Grand-daughter, Susan.

William Hartnell played the Doctor for 3 years, from November 1963 to October 1966.

During his time in the role the series won great popularity. Of particular note was the success of the Daleks, perhaps the definitive Doctor Who monster.

Also of note during this period were a number of 'historical' stories, these were later phased out, which had their roots in the original programme concept that it educate as well as entertain. It is, however, interesting to note that this original concept precluded the inclusion of "bug eyed monsters" in Doctor Who - Daleks!?!

Hartnell's last story, The Tenth Planet, introduced another famous Who monster - The Cybermen!

Sadly many episodes from the Hartnell era are now 'missing' from the BBC Archives and only survive in audio and off-air photographic form. More details of these 'missing' stories can be found on our Missing Episodes pages.

Hartnell relinquished the role to Patrick Troughton in 1966 due to ill health.
